
Wanted to replace my front derailleur cable since it was frayed. Removed the old cable and was able to see the hole and run the cable through the shifter no issues. After setting everything up i wanted to test the shifting. I was able to shift up once but could not shift to the third crank. Shifted down and now i am unable to shift up at all. Was going to start over but now i cant even remove the cable from the shifter. The piece that allows the cable head to sit on is out of place and will not budge even with force. Shifter is shimano 105

If the shifter is actuated without tension on the cable it can get unseated from where it should be, try pulling some tension on the cable then shifting it back to the bottom position
